Rethink Autism

Friday, November 13, 2009 10:03 No Comments

As reported on Abc news, Rethink Autism is a new Web site designed to help teach parents the fundamentals of ABA (applied behavior analysis) so that parents can go it alone. 
 
For a monthly fee, the Web site offers web-based video guides on how to work the magic of ABA so that parents can help their [...]
